History

Clear Creek Cemetery lies east of Bangs in Brown County, on land donated by L.L. and Mary W. Childress through a deed dated April 13, 1901. Its oldest grave is that of A.E. Starkey, who died in 1879, and the grounds are kept up by an active cemetery association.
